The applicant is proposing a new commercial center, the Niumalu Market Center, <br />located between Lanihau Center and Henry Street, makai of Queen Ka‘ahumanu <br />Highway, consisting of 185,650 gross leasable area within 14 buildings. <br />The anchor tenant and six (6) surrounding buildings are all one story in height with <br />some heights closer to two stories. These seven (7) buildings are all with flat roofs with <br />no surrounding mansard roofing or other feature to hide the flat roofs. The remaining <br />seven (7) buildings include two (2) two-story structures with the balance as one-story <br />structures. All of these seven (7) buildings include mansard roofing around all sides. <br />These structures are primarily offices with one location for a series of gasoline pumps. <br />The entire site includes 758 parking spaces. The mauka portion of the site is <br />approximately 20-25 feet lower than Queen Ka‘ahumanu Highway and as the site <br />extends makai, it eventually drops in elevation below the existing elevation of Alahou <br />Street. The site is accessible from Henry Street (current inactive mauka traffic signal) <br />and from the road that currently extends beyond Alahou Street to Lanihau Center. <br />Landscaping Plan indicates significant planting around and within the proposed center. <br />Applicant: Sentinel Development <br />Landowner: PRII Westwood Lanihau Expansion LLC <br />TMK: (3) 7-5-004: 007 <br />Location: Street Address has not been assigned <br />Hawaii County is an Equal Opportunity Provider and Employer. <br /> <br />
